[PATCH v1 11/12] serial: 8250: don't use slave_id of dma_slave_config

From: Andy Shevchenko
Date: Tue Aug 19 2014 - 13:31:12 EST


That field has been deprecated in favour of getting the necessary information
from ACPI or DT.

However, we still need to deal systems that are PCI only (no ACPI to back up)
like Intel Bay Trail. In order to support such systems, we explicitly bind
setup() to the appropriate DMA filter function and its corresponding parameter.
Then when serial8250_request_dma() doesn't find the channel via ACPI or DT, it
falls back to use the given filter function.
